Car 12 - Cattle Car. Parked at Derby Castle in 1904, just after rebuilding into the unique 'Cattle Car' from passenger carrying format. [but this statement is clearly contradicted by info here - en.wikipedia.org/wiki/Manx_Electric_Cars_10-13 ] Another two cars were 'Sheep Trailer' cars. There were loading docks for livestock at Derby Castle, Laxey and Ramsey, allowing livestock moves between these main towns. info & image "nicked off another site" after being sent a link ... 4-wheel Brake van E.5 [built 1876] at end of the south line platform in Douglas Station. [Image date ?? 1950s / 1960s ?? ] In two-tone [brown ?] livery, with the duckets removed and boarded up. The doors aren't in the best of condition and the main waist panel has a long split - at least 12", maybe 18" long in it. Long since scrapped. . Not my Image : Fair Use & public information

F51 - at Douglas Station [note canopy] probably on the schools service. {some of the bodywork panelling - which will be 3/8" sheets of Mahogany - is showing signs of failure by cracking along the grain.} F51 was formed in 1912 by mounting the 4-wheeler bodies B3 and B5 onto a steel bogie underframe. The bodies were scrapped in 1968 and the "runner" underframe was sold off later. . . Not my Image : Fair Use & public information
